In the Name of the Fergie
Fergie doesn't want to be known by or called Fergalicious anymore. "It's kind of old now," she said without irony, apparently not realizing that adding "alicious" to words was already ancient when she appended it to her name. "People have said it; they've gone into Burgerlicious, and all these things. It's so over, so last year. New year, new word. I've got to figure the new word out. But it will come, it will come." Of course, Stacy Ann Ferguson's professional name of "Fergie" itself was tired right from the get-go, having been the nickname of Prince Andrew's wife, Sarah Ferguson, the Duchess of Kent, years earlier. We suggest the singer, newly engaged to former All My Children star Josh Duhamel, let someone else this time come up with her next "new word." (Starpulse)
